Dubai's recent COP28 brought the international community together at a critical juncture to bring about transformative climate action. With 75% of global greenhouse gas emissions, cities are at the forefront of the fight against climate change. It means that green initiatives will be instrumental in meeting the targets set at the 2015 Paris Agreement. On this edition of The Hub, Wang Guan sat with a panel of city officials and stakeholders at the China Pavilion at the COP28 to discuss how major cities like Dubai in the United Arab Emirates, Sydney in Australia, and Shanghai, Yantai and Fuzhou in China go about synergizing concrete climate actions such as green transition and carbon trading on one hand and socioeconomic development on the other. These cities have provided original and replicable solutions based on their respective strengths and are on the way to achieving a smooth green transition while taking advantage of opportunities in terms of growth and development.
